This module is part of the new 3-year BA (Hons) French degree (R102) of which one semester is delivered at ULIP. It consists of a<br />

STUDY ONLY Research Project (2,000-2,500 words).<br />

In term 3, after the assessment period at the end of their second year, students will remain in Paris throughout the rest of the<br />

term <strong>and</strong> the vacation to complete a study only (non credit-bearing) piece of work. This is designed to develop research skills <strong>and</strong><br />

independent study; to enhance critical <strong>and</strong> cultural engagement; to optimize transferable skills; to further boost language skills,<br />

<strong>and</strong> to give added value in terms of exit velocity as students return to London for their final year. The project takes the form of<br />

EITHER an essay relating to a content module (a module taken in Year Two, for which additional research has been undertaken, or<br />

a module the student intends to take in Year Three), OR a cultural fieldwork report relating to an aspect of the experience of<br />

living or working in France. Students taking this latter option will be encouraged to take up a work experience placement.<br />

The Project will be written in French. ULIP library <strong>and</strong> computing facilities will be available to students until the end of July.<br />

Guidance will be provided by ULIP staff <strong>and</strong> by QMUL staff via VLE / email. The Project will be submitted at the start of Year 3.<br />

Students will benefit from formative feedback which will help them to focus on the requirements of their final year.<br />
